
Acy S Tablet
Marketer
Yeoman Drugs
Salt Composition
Aceclofenac (100mg) + Paracetamol (325mg) + Serratiopeptidase (15mg)
Overview Acy S Tablet
Combiflam-S tablets combine medications to ease pain and reduce swelling in diverse conditions, including muscle aches, joint pain, and post-surgical discomfort. This dual action effectively manages inflammation and pain associated with ailments such as rheumatoid arthritis, ankylosing spondylitis, and osteoarthritis. Dosage and treatment duration for Combiflam-S should strictly adhere to your physician's instructions. Administering the tablet with food or milk minimizes potential stomach irritation. Consistent, timely intake optimizes therapeutic efficacy. Continue the prescribed regimen until your doctor advises cessation. Commonly reported side effects include nausea, vomiting, abdominal pain, indigestion, heartburn, elevated liver enzymes, vertigo, somnolence, and diarrhea. For extended treatment, regular monitoring of kidney function, liver function, and blood counts may be necessary. Prolonged use carries a risk of serious complications, such as gastrointestinal bleeding and renal impairment. Combiflam-S is contraindicated during pregnancy and lactation.

How Acy S Tablet works:
Acy S Tablet combines Aceclofenac, Paracetamol, and Serratiopeptidase to alleviate pain and inflammation. Aceclofenac, a non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ID), and the analgesic Paracetamol, reduce pain and fever by inhibiting the production of inflammatory mediators. Serratiopeptidase, a proteolytic enzyme, further aids healing by selectively degrading damaged proteins in inflamed tissues.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Consuming alcohol alongside Acy S Tablet is inadvisable.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Use of Acy S Tablet during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scant, animal studies indicate potential harm to a developing fetus. A physician will assess the potential benefits against possible risks prior to prescription. Seek medical advice.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Data on Acy S Tablet use while breastfeeding is absent. Seek your physician's advice.
DrivingUNSAFE
Taking Acy S Tablet might reduce attentiveness, impair vision, or cause drowsiness and dizziness. Driving should be avoided if these effects are experienced.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with kidney impairment should use Acy S Tablet c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Consult a physician before use. Acy S Tablet is contraindicated in individuals with severely compromised kidney function.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with liver impairment should use Acy S Tablet c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Physician consultation is advised. Acy S Tablet is contraindicated for individuals with severe or active liver disease.
